On-street parking: paid hours and changing rules by street

In Eindhoven, on-street parking is generally regulated as paid parking in many central and ring-area locations, typically from 09:00 to 21:00, 7 days a week (including Sundays and public holidays). Exact tariffs and maximum parking durations can differ by zone, so the safest approach is to confirm the rules for the specific street you plan to use.

No blue zone on-street—watch for “free pockets” instead

In Eindhoven there are generally no blue zones for on-street parking like you may see elsewhere. Some areas are known for “green parking zones” where parking may be free, but whether a particular street near Nieuwe Erven falls under a free pocket can vary—so verify it for the exact location before you park.

How to pay for street parking in Eindhoven

For paid street parking, you’ll typically pay either:

  • At the parking machine (you enter your license plate; payment is usually card-based, not a paper ticket for behind the windshield).
  • With a parking app (mobile parking lets you start/stop your session and pay based on your actual parking time).

Resident permits and visitor arrangements (what it means for your trip)

In areas with paid parking or permit zones, residents and businesses may apply for permits. Permit applications in Eindhoven are handled digitally via the city e-services, and a login (DigiD) is required. Costs depend on the parking zone your address belongs to (for example, resident permits are described as ranging between €4.56 and €23.87 per month from 1 January 2026).

P+R Meerhoven for long stays (and lower hassle than hunting streets)

If you’re planning a longer stay around Eindhoven and want a predictable alternative to street parking near Nieuwe Erven, P+R Meerhoven is a commonly used option. Tariffs are described as €4.00 for the first 24 hours, and from the second day €5.00 per day. This can work well if you’re comfortable taking public transport onward.
